Night to Remember [Criterion Collection]

Features:
  • Optimal image quality
  • Dual-layer edition
  • Digital transfer with restored image and sound in original aspect ratio of 1.66:1
  • Screen-specific audio commentary by Don Lynch, author, and Ken Marschall, illustrator of "Titanic -- an Illustrated History"
  • The Making of A Night to Remember" [1993], a 60-minute documentary featuring William MacQuitty's rare behind-the-scenes footage
